From Historic Cobham to Bustling Epsom: Your Taxi Route
The journey from Cobham, a picturesque village known for its historic charm and leafy surroundings, to Epsom, a vibrant market town famous for its racecourse, is a common route for both residents and visitors alike. While public transport options exist, such as taking a bus via Cromwell Road Bus Station, which can take around 1 hour and 28 minutes, a taxi offers a considerably faster and more direct alternative.
By road, the distance between Cobham and Epsom is approximately 8 to 10 miles, depending on the specific starting and ending points and the chosen route. A taxi journey covering this distance typically takes between 20 to 35 minutes, traffic permitting. This significant time saving can be invaluable, especially during peak hours when bus services might experience delays or when you simply want to maximise your time in either location.
Estimated Taxi Fare: Cobham to Epsom
Taxi fares in the UK are generally calculated based on distance, time, and sometimes additional factors like time of day (e.g., higher rates for night journeys) or specific surcharges (e.g., airport fees, extra passengers/luggage). For a journey from Cobham to Epsom, you can expect an estimated fare ranging from £25 to £40. It's important to note that this is an estimate; actual prices can vary between different taxi companies. We highly recommend getting a quote from a local Cobham or Epsom taxi firm before you travel, especially if you're pre-booking.

Connecting Epsom to Effingham Junction by Taxi
Another popular route within Surrey connects the lively town of Epsom with the more rural Effingham Junction, a smaller village primarily known for its railway station which serves as a key commuter link. The train is a common choice for this journey, with South Western Railway operating hourly services that take approximately 16 minutes and cost between £3 and £8. However, for those seeking ultimate flexibility, direct access, or travelling outside train operating hours, a taxi presents a compelling alternative.
The road distance between Epsom and Effingham Junction is roughly 5 to 7 miles. A taxi ride between these two points would typically take around 15 to 25 minutes, depending on traffic conditions and the precise pick-up and drop-off locations. While the train is quicker in terms of pure travel time on the tracks, the door-to-door convenience of a taxi often makes the overall journey time comparable, especially when factoring in walking to and from stations, and potential waiting times for trains.
Estimated Taxi Fare: Epsom to Effingham Junction
Similar to the Cobham to Epsom route, taxi fares for the Epsom to Effingham Junction journey will depend on the taxi company, time of day, and specific mileage. An estimated fare for this route would typically fall within the range of £18 to £30. Again, it is always advisable to obtain a precise quote from a reputable local taxi service prior to your journey to avoid any surprises. Many taxi companies offer fixed fares for common routes, which can provide peace of mind.

Understanding Taxi Fares: What Influences the Cost?
While we've provided estimated fares for your journeys, it's important to understand the various factors that can influence the final price of your taxi ride in Surrey. Being aware of these can help you better budget for your travel and understand any variations in pricing.
- Distance and Time: This is the primary determinant. Fares are typically calculated based on a combination of the distance travelled and the time taken, especially if the vehicle is stationary or moving slowly in traffic.
- Time of Day: Journeys during peak hours (e.g., morning and evening commutes) may be subject to higher rates due to increased demand and potential for slower travel speeds. Late-night journeys (typically after 11 PM or midnight) and early morning trips often incur a higher night tariff.
- Day of the Week: Weekend rates, particularly on Saturday nights, can sometimes be higher than weekday rates. Bank holidays also often attract premium pricing.
- Type of Vehicle: Standard saloon cars will have a base rate, while larger vehicles like MPVs (Multi-Purpose Vehicles) for more passengers or executive cars for a more luxurious experience may command a higher fare.
- Number of Passengers and Luggage: While standard fares usually accommodate 4 passengers and a reasonable amount of luggage, extremely large amounts of luggage or additional passengers requiring a larger vehicle might incur a small surcharge. Always inform the taxi company if you have oversized items.
- Waiting Time: If the driver has to wait for you at the pick-up location beyond a short grace period, waiting time charges may apply. This is more common with pre-booked services.
- Tolls and Congestion Charges: While less common for journeys purely within Surrey, if your route happens to cross any toll roads or enter specific zones with charges (e.g., London Congestion Charge if travelling further afield), these will be added to your fare.
- Fixed Fares vs. Metered Fares: Some taxi companies offer fixed fares for common routes, which means you know the exact cost upfront, regardless of traffic. Metered fares are calculated by the taxi's meter based on the distance and time, and are standard for shorter, un-prebooked trips. Always clarify which method will be used.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
How do I book a taxi in Cobham or Epsom?
You can book a taxi by calling a local taxi company directly, using their website, or through popular ride-hailing apps that operate in the area. Pre-booking is recommended, especially for specific times or longer journeys.
Are taxis available 24/7 in Cobham and Epsom?
Many larger taxi companies in the Epsom and Cobham areas operate 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, including public holidays. However, availability might be limited during very late or early hours, so pre-booking is always advisable.
Can I pay by card in a taxi?
Most modern taxi services and ride-hailing apps accept debit and credit card payments. However, it's always a good idea to confirm with the taxi company when booking, as some smaller or independent drivers might prefer cash.
How much luggage can I take in a taxi?
A standard saloon taxi can typically accommodate two large suitcases and two carry-on bags. If you have more luggage or oversized items, it's best to inform the taxi company when booking so they can send a larger vehicle, such as an estate car or an MPV.
Is it cheaper to pre-book a taxi?
Often, yes. Pre-booking allows the taxi company to plan their routes more efficiently and can often secure you a fixed fare, which might be more economical than a metered fare, especially during busy periods or if there's unexpected traffic.
What if my journey is delayed or I need to change my pick-up time?
It's crucial to inform the taxi company as soon as possible if your plans change. Most reputable firms are flexible and will do their best to accommodate changes, though charges may apply for significant delays or last-minute cancellations.
Are child seats provided by taxi services?
While taxis are generally exempt from child car seat laws, some companies can provide child seats upon request. Always confirm this when booking to ensure availability, and specify the age/weight of the child if possible.
